Transforming a cabinet is easy with a few simple tricks:

  1. Don’t be afraid of the mess!

    I sometimes seem paralyzed at the thought of pulling everything out of a cabinet onto the counter, but it is essential to getting started. Just keep a vision of the beautiful end result while you dig through junk!

  2. Use an adhesive wallpaper:

    I found this cute, inexpensive wallpaper off of Amazon and I love how it makes the cabinet feels happy. Wallpaper was easily installed in under ten minutes.

  3. Cute baskets and jars are everything:

    Use matching baskets and matching glass jars to make the cabinet feel pulled together. These jars and these baskets are some of our favorites.

  4. Identify your pretty cabinets:

    I understand that not all cabinets are going to be beautiful and that is ok! However, we all need a few cabinets that we open and make us feel happy. So decorate the inside of those cabinets and put your favorite sentimental dishes in a spot you can often see them so you actually remember to use them, instead of being tucked in the back of your pantry never seen.

  5. Contain with Trays

    A great way to contain smaller items is using a tray. Items still feel well organized when they are on a tray instead of roaming the cupboard.
